    for spy:

    i spent an entire round sitting in the spy spawn throwing down flash/smoke/jammers just to see is simply USING gadgets was enough to raise your ability score, and guess what? I'm sitting at 100% now...

    the next round, i played as normal, but took EVERY opportunity to JUMP between areas, and to use ESCAPE MOVES to climb up into ceilings, and into vents / through windows... and i'm sitting at 100% now...

    I have YET to try sneaking into an area, near an objective, and simply HIDING in the ceiling waiting until the end of the round - to see if i can get 100% stealth - but i'll be doing so soon.

    for merc:

    i was able to raise "tracking" to 100% simply through playing the game normally, so i'm not sure of the criteria necessary to raise that stat, sorry

    "equipment" i'm assuming, is going to work just like the spy - so i will attempt sitting in merc spawn and grenading / droning repeatedly for a round, and report my findings...

    "direct action" i'm not exactly sure about the criteria needed to raise this one either - some have suggested "running and gunning" is the way to raise it, others that you have to melee the spies - seeing as how i've only melee'd one spy, and my rating is sitting at 4%... i don't doubt this one really?
